The objective of this work is the study of dynamic performance of packed bed using n-tetradecane as PCM during charging process. According to the energy balance between the capsules and coolant, a dynamic charging process model of packed bed using cool storage capsules is established. The performance of charging process is simulated using numerical method. The temperature of PCM and HTF, melting fraction and cool thermal energy releasing rate are illustrated. The influences of the inlet temperature, initial temperature and flow rate of coolant and porosity on the complete solidification and charging are also discussed.
